In a year marked by significant challenges for the residential real estate market, Compass has demonstrated exceptional resilience and performance. With single-family home resale transactions plummeting to their lowest levels in nearly three decades, the company reported a robust revenue increase in the fourth quarter, rising 26% year over year to a total of $1.4 billion. This surge in financial performance can be attributed to a 24% increase in transaction volume, suggesting that Compass successfully capitalized on market opportunities during a time when many competitors struggled. Their strategic initiatives appear to have resonated with both buyers and sellers, allowing the firm not only to maintain but also to grow its market presence in a contracting environment.

Throughout the year, Compass achieved impressive financial milestones, culminating in total revenue of $5.6 billion and the generation of $122 million in operating cash flow. This positive cash flow indicates a solid operational foundation and effective cost management despite external pressures.
